Decoding Essential Wood Boring Bit Types

Professional tool collections categorize drill bits by their specialized functions in woodworking applications:

  • Bell Hanger Bits: Engineered for long-reach wall penetrations, their slender shafts and precision tips navigate confined spaces effortlessly, making them indispensable for electrical installations.
  • Self-Feed Bits: Innovative threaded tips pull the bit through material autonomously, reducing operator fatigue when boring large-diameter deep holes without excessive downward pressure.
  • Ship Auger Bits: Superior chip evacuation systems make these ideal for drilling dense or moisture-laden timber, producing clean holes without tear-out.
  • Spade Bits: The workhorse of wood shops, these combine rapid penetration with cost-effectiveness for general-purpose joinery and framing.

Selecting Your Optimal Boring Tool

Choosing the right bit involves careful consideration of three critical factors:

Material Compatibility: Cutting geometries vary significantly between softwoods, hardwoods, and engineered composites—each requiring specific flute designs and cutting angles for optimal performance.

Technical Specifications: Beyond diameter selection, professionals evaluate shank types (hexagonal vs. round), maximum drilling depth capacity, and torque requirements to ensure seamless integration with power tools.

Performance Engineering: Premium-grade bits incorporate hardened steel construction, laser-sharpened cutting edges, and advanced heat treatments to maintain sharpness through extended use.

Advanced Techniques for Professional Results

Seasoned woodworkers prioritize bits with nail-cutting capability when working with reclaimed lumber or renovation projects, preventing catastrophic edge damage from hidden fasteners. For deep boring applications, extension adapters maintain bit stability while preserving hole perpendicularity.
